I'm trying to manually scan in some audio channels on my V7 Combo but I'm not having any luck. The receiver scans in a few audio channels but lyngsat.com shows more. I get to the active transponder and go to do a scan using the PID entry but I'm not sure what numbers to use. Does anyone know what goes in the Video PID, Audio PID and PCR? I'm trying for SES3 at 103w using 12145V 20000. Lyngsat lists an audio PID of 7496 for example.

Thank you for the reply but I think you misunderstood what I'm trying to do. I have a good signal on the transponder but only four audio channels will scan in. I want to manually key in the PID's to receive other stations. The manual doesn't explain how to do this but I do see the manual entry PID popup screen when I go to scan the transponder. I was able to do this with a receiver I had in the past and the V7 should be able to do this since the option is there to put in the PID's I'm just having no luck with the numbers. I think I heard you have to put some number like 9000 in as a video PID and that tells the receiver that it is an audio channel. The audio and PCR PID's are entered from a website like lyngsat.
